Product Overview
The Cisco Catalyst 9200CX C9200CX-8P-2X2G-A is a compact yet powerful Layer 2 and Layer 3 managed switch purpose-built for enterprise edge deployments requiring high throughput, advanced security, and flexible networking. Designed to support PoE+ devices, it comes equipped with 8-port 1G PoE+ interfaces and a total PoE power budget of 240W, serving IP phones, cameras, and wireless access points efficiently. Enhanced with 2x10G SFP+ and 2x1G copper fixed uplinks, it ensures fast and scalable backbone connectivity suitable for evolving business demands.
This 1U wired switch features robust enterprise-grade capabilities including support for IPv4/IPv6, RIPv1/v2, and OSPFv3 routing protocols, offering advanced network segmentation and resilience. With a MAC address table supporting 32,000 entries and jumbo frame support up to 9198 bytes, the 9200CX provides traffic optimization and effective packet forwarding. The device also integrates remote management protocols like SNMP, Syslog, and DHCP, backed by advanced security mechanisms with AES encryption and compliance with IEEE standards.
Built to endure, it boasts a Mean Time Between Failures (MTBF) of 736,000 hours and functions within an operating range of -5°C to 45°C. Plug-and-play enabled with Cisco IOS XE and Smart Licensing, the 9200CX switch streamlines deployment and operations. With 4 GB RAM and 8 GB flash memory, alongside a limited lifetime warranty, it’s a solid investment for secure and high-availability networking infrastructures.
